How much do concrete sales j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average yearly pay for concrete sales in Raleigh, NC is $74,424.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,100.00 and $95,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a concrete sales?

A Concrete Sales job involves selling concrete products and services to contractors, builders, and construction companies. Responsibilities include generating leads, building relationships with clients, providing product recommendations, and ensuring customer satisfaction. Sales representatives must understand different types of concrete mixtures, pricing, and delivery logistics. Strong communication and negotiation skills are essential for success in this role.

What are some common challenges faced in concrete sales, and how can they be addressed?

Concrete sales professionals often encounter challenges such as managing fluctuating demand due to construction project cycles, addressing complex client requirements, and navigating logistical constraints like delivery scheduling. Overcoming these challenges usually involves strong organizational skills, proactive communication with both clients and logistics teams, and a thorough understanding of your company's product offerings. Building lasting relationships with clients and maintaining up-to-date market knowledge can help you anticipate demands and offer effective solutions. With experience, many professionals learn to balance multiple projects simultaneously and develop strategies for meeting sales quotas even in slower market periods.
